Promises Kept

Speaker: Don Rayman Series: Genesis Scripture: Genesis 21:1–34, 1:1

Main Point: The God who makes promises, provides for the promises he makes.

Outline:

  1. Promise Kept (vv. 1-7)
  2. Promise Threatened (vv. 8-13)
  3. Promise Protected (vv. 14-21)

Quote

Satan promises the best, but pays with the worst; he promises honor, and pays with disgrace; he promises pleasure, and pays with pain; he promises profit, and pays with loss; he promises life, and pays with death. But God pays as He promises; all His payments are made in pure gold.

Thomas Brooks
1608-1680
